Output 583891d2f40c010ae33ead06915ec37a3f747386e09d9dcce523f55b5fcebfd7:16

value
7405952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 570fd89c2738553add9848fe8066407c5c17a98c OP_EQUAL
address
39dMhEy1HNDbYz6KMrHnnr89aakT3MiEkt
transaction
583891d2f40c010ae33ead06915ec37a3f747386e09d9dcce523f55b5fcebfd7
spent
true